* Permissible limits of the voltage range at which the unit operates satisfactorily.
# Unit ampacity = 125 percent of largest operating component's full load amps plus 100 percent of all other potential operating components' (EAC, humidifier,
etc.) full load amps.
{
Time-delay type is recommended.
}
Length shown is as measured one way along wire path between furnace and service panel for maximum 2 percent voltage drop.
